Richard “Ric” Allen Gough
Age 70, of Lapeer, peacefully passed away on Wednesday, August 5, 2026. In accordance with his wishes, cremation has taken place. Expressions of sympathy may be shared with the family on Richard’s tribute wall at detroitcremationsociety.com.
Born in Flint on April 9, 1956, Richard was the son of Mr. and Mrs. William and Patricia (Brown) Gough. Educated locally, Richard graduated from Kearsley High School in 1974. Shortly after graduation, he began his career with General Motors working as an electrician. He dedicated 35 years to his career before his well-earned retirement in 2011. Richard married the love of his life, Mary Lynn Mokan, on August 6, 1976. The two shared 50 years of happiness, love, and prosperity together, creating many memories both would cherish forever. Richard cherished his children and grandchildren, loving them with all his heart.
In his free time, Richard loved spending time outdoors. He looked forward to opening day for hunting season every year. When he wasn’t hunting, he would spend his time on the St. Marys River fishing. Most of all, he enjoyed spending time with his family and friends.
Left to cherish his memory is his beloved wife of 50 years, Mary Gough; his children: William Gough of Gowanda, New York, and Kate Gough of East Point, Michigan; his granddaughters: Margaret and Josie of North Collins, New York; his brother: John Gough of Lennon, Michigan; his sister: Sharon Nuttle and brother in-law, Kelly Nuttle of Port Orange, Florida; as well as many cherished nieces, nephews, and cousins.
Richard was preceded in death by his parents, William and Patricia Gough.
The family would like to extend their gratitude to the staff of Residential Hospice and the LaVigne Home for Compassionate Care for the love and support provided to Richard and the family.
